<h3 >INSTALLATION GUIDELINES</h3>

<ul >

<li><p >Use a screwdriver with a precise depth-sensitive clutch

and speeds of up to 5000 RPM</p></li>

<li><p >Overdriving may cause a weak connection</p></li>

<li><p >The drive is finished when the screw is just below the

work surface without tearing the paper</p></li>

<li><p >1” of penetration is suggested for drywall to wood

applications</p></li></ul>
